What is this?

A simplification of full data cycle, from raw data being gathered (web scrapping), processed (data pipeline), analyzed (statistic modeled), until presented (with data interactivity). The objective of this project is to show how data being translated from one to another state and the stakeholders of the process. Most part of the project are written in Python.

Project structure, tech, and stakeholder

*The technology is chosen based on simplicity to be taught / debug project structure

The project structure, consist of:

  • data_collector (Data Engineer) : web scrapping downloader script (Python, Bash - selenium, requests, beautifulsoup).
  • data_processor (Data Engineer) : parsing, normalize, and geocoding (Python - multiprocessing, pandas, geopandas, shapely).
  • data_analysis (Data Scientist / Business Analyst) : statistical simulation, aggregation, visualization (Python - dask, jupyter, plotly)
  • presentation (Data Scientist / Business Analyst) : craft and tell the important data into understandable form (Python, Javascript, CSS - jupyter, reveal js, rise)

In this case there isn't, but in industry there area also this roles:

  • data tracking (Data Engineer) : Design a robust and streamline data pipeline to get user activities.
  • dashboard (Business Intelligence) : Make monitoring dashboard to help business user take decision quickly.
  • prediction model (Data Scientist / ML Engineer) : Make a prediction model to solve business problem (could be predict the future / detect fraud / recommending item).


Setup

*The project haven't been tested on windows.

Recommended to use Anaconda for setup project environment, because there is a lot of non-python package. Create new environment using requirement_conda.yml. Here is how to setup the project folder, from clone to install the environment:

git clone https://github.com/curiouslaw/taipei_food_industry_insight
cd taipei_food_industry_insight
conda env create --file requirements_conda.yml --prefix ./conda-env

then to activate the environment, use this command.

conda activate ./conda-env

To run below command, you need to use the environment (in env active state).

There might be some non-python package that would be used for some case. The lis is in file unix_requirements.txt. Please install with apt-get / other for linux or brew for mac.
